HK Lee - Chief Executive Officer
HK Lee founded Kaltec Electronics (KE) in 1990. KE provided computer hardware services and distribution. He is a pioneer in the development of digital video recorders (DVR) and network video recorders (NVR) for enterprise applications. He created the DW® brand in 1998 for KE, broadening his product line to offer complete systems for the surveillance industry. Mr. Lee received a degree in electrical engineering in Seoul, Korea and spent seven years working for the R&D department of Kwanglim Electronics before starting KE.
Wade Thomas - President and Chief Operating Officer
Security industry veteran Wade Thomas joined Kaltec Electronics / DW® Inc. in 2008 as President and Chief Operating Officer, responsible for sales, marketing and operations. Mr. Thomas is on the Board of Directors of Network Optix, an enterprise video software development company, and is a Managing Member of Innovative Security Designs LLC (ISD). He was President of the Americas and VP Sales North America at Samsung CCTV / GVI Security Solutions Inc., VP Sales North America for Tri-Ed Distribution, President of Securus Technologies Group (STG) and Owner / President of Pacific Rim Security / General Security Systems.
Steve Adamczak - Vice President of North America Sales
Steve Adamczak, Vice President of North America Sales, came to DW® in 2010 and has more than 22 years of experience in security and surveillance. He was National Sales Manager for Dedicated Micros and had sales leadership responsibilities at ADI. Mr. Adamczak has a Bachelor of Science in Justice and Policy from Guilford College.
Sunghyun Kim (Paul S. Kim) - Head of Research and Development
Paul S. Kim joined Digital Watchdog as a Software Engineer in 2015. He has developed several DW applications and contributed to the establishment of DW’s R&D division in 2022. Currently, Mr. Kim designs and oversee the myDW Cloud Service. He holds a bachelor’s degree in Electronics and a Master’s Degree in Computer Systems. After completing graduate studies, Mr. Kim worked at Samsung Electronics’ Network Division for 10 years, where he developed 3G and 4G mobile communication equipment. During this time, Mr. Kim collaborated with major global telecom operators including NTT (Japan), AT&T (USA), and Sprint (USA). Since 2010, he has led software development teams and developed various security surveillance products and solutions, including IP cameras, network video recorders, and cloud video surveillance solutions.
Patrick Kelly - Senior Director of Strategy
Patrick Kelly, Senior Director of Strategy, has a long history of success with implementing video systems solutions in a variety of applications, from large school districts to complex installations at regional airports and seaports. Prior to Digital Watchdog, he worked with end users, distributors, regional systems integrators, national and global resellers, integration partners, A&Es and consultants as a manufacturer's representative. Kelly holds a degree in Business Management from Florida Atlantic University.
Jim Somerville - Director of Strategic Accounts
Jim Somerville, Director of Strategic Accounts, develops corporate level relationships with National and Regional Systems Integrators and drives sales down through their local offices. Jim has more than 40 years of experience in the security industry, which includes operations, manufacturing, distribution and sales. Some of the companies he has worked for include Honeywell Security Solutions, ADI, Anixter-TriEd [WESCO], OpenEye and Dedicated Micros. Jim has been managing national accounts for more than 20 years.
Mark Espenschied - Director of Marketing
Mark Espenschied, Director of Marketing, joined DW® in 2014. He has 19 years of experience specific to the video surveillance industry and more than 40 years of experience in publishing, marketing, advertising and sales. Mark was previously Director of Marketing Communications at Arecont Vision, Associate Director of Marketing at D-Link Systems and Director of Marketing at Meade Instruments Corp. Following two years abroad in Taiwan R.O.C. and undergraduate studies at the University of Utah and Brigham Young University, Mark earned a bachelor of science degree in Communication with a minor in English from Weber State College.
